

Carved and painted wooden figure of Wangye, a pestilence god, wearing gold robes and blue, green, and orange stripes of paint across the face. He holds a green object across his body, and sits on a red, black, and gold throne.
Part of The Louise Tythacott Collection . The Louise Tythacott Collection was compiled as the result of intensive fieldwork over several years in South China and Hong Kong. Ms Tythacott is a Chinese-speaking anthropologist and a museum curator, and was Curator of Ethnography at Liverpool Museum, who was particularly fortunate in developing contacts during the course of her work. Ms Tythacott has also made collections for the Museum of Mankind.
